I always thought that the BX55 service was great when it (and the BX29) used Washignton Ave sounthbound and Third Ave northbound. The buses moved along at good speed and there wasn't much congestion like Third Ave is nowadays with two-way traffic flow. The BX55 buses serving 149th-3rd Ave also made good time on Melrose Ave. It was always that special route that was known as the express, didn't accept Add-A-Ride transfers, free transfers to/from the subway. Even us students (at the time) knew that you needed to have a train pass (They didn't accept bus pass on the BX55) or they had to ride the BX29.You all may also remember that the BX55 had separate bus stops from local routes. |
